TVC meeting held

Chandigarh, A meeting of Town Vending Committee, Chandigarh was held in MCC, here today under the chairmanship of Sh. K.K. Yadav, IAS, Commissioner, Municipal Corporation, Chandigarh.
All members of TVC including Sh. V.N. Sharma, Mrs. Sangita Vardhan, Sh. Sita Ram, Sh. Ram Pal, representatives from traffic police, SSP, SDM’s and other officials of MCC were present during the meeting.
The committee approved the agenda item regarding hiring of 9 security guards and one supervisor at street vending zone of sector 15 for six months. The committee also accorded approval to hiring additional staff in street vending cell for six months. The committee accorded ex post facto approval for the expenditure incurred during shifting of vendors.
The committee discussed the issue regarding provision of some other vending zones in different areas throughout city considering demands of area public. The committee discussed and decided to develop Model street vending zone in city on pilot basis by providing smart lighting through use of solar lights, public toilets, drinking water facility, GIS mapping and profile, providing uniform kiosks and thermoplastic demarcation of vending zone alongwith solar passage lights.
The committee also accorded approval to extend the pilot project signed with school of public health, PGI on developing IEC material and capacity building of street vendors.
The committee members also discussed complaints/representations received from registered vendors and provision of more space for motor mechanics, potters, tandoor workers, change of trade within non essential service provider category due to loss of business during re-location, cluster of vending/regrouping will be explored for street vendors in sector 15 zone for creating zones within zones for different trade to avoid any fire incident and transfer of ownership in case of recent death and allotment of site as per provisions.
The committee also accorded approval to sanction of honorarium to TVC non official members for attending various meetings other than TVC and engagement of non-government organizations (working on community development, IEC and theater/street plays) and change of fee category zone due to re-location.
